YLD logo

Senior Software Engineer (React/Node)

YLD

About the Role

As a Senior Software Engineer at YLD, you will be an integral part of a client team tasked with building innovative products. We are looking for someone who is curious, passionate, driven, and enthusiastic about software development. You should be proficient in problem-solving and crafting scalable, resilient, and fault-tolerant architectures. Effective communication and teamwork are essential as you will be working in a fast-paced engineering environment to achieve outstanding results and deliver exciting projects.

Responsibilities

  • Crafting Excellent Products: As a Full Stack Engineer, you will be responsible for building new features that meet the needs of our clients' customers and improving their digital platforms.
  • Continuous Delivery: You will be continuously delivering changes to products as our client moves to a full CI/CD model.
  • Collaboration: Work closely with your team, regularly collaborating on engineering initiatives to continually push yourselves to be better.
  • Show and Tell: Participate in regular show and tells to promote your work to both your department and the wider company.
  • Client Engagement: Join our clients' internal events, including meeting external speakers and attending social events.

Required Skills and Experience

  • Proven commercial experience with React and Node.js.
  • Strong proficiency in JavaScript, including concepts like asynchronous programming, closures, and ES6.
  • Experience with GraphQL.
  • Familiarity with distributed version control systems (e.g., Git).
  • Experience with both relational and schema-less databases.
  • Strong focus on continuous integration and delivery.
  • Strong focus on Test-Driven Development (TDD).
  • Experience in building high-performance and scalable applications.
  • Good understanding of the design and implementation of RESTful web services.
  • Familiarity with performance monitoring tools.
  • Ability to maintain composure when debugging production issues.

About You

  • Self-motivated, proactive, and always looking for ways to improve and develop yourself.
  • A good communicator, both in writing and verbally, able to explain technical ideas and concepts in business-friendly language.
  • Detail-oriented with strong problem-solving skills that balance innovation with pragmatic technology choices to solve business needs.
  • Used to working in a team-oriented, collaborative environment.
  • Analytical and problem-solving oriented.
  • A genuine believer in diversity and fairness.
  • Legally able to live and work in Portugal.

Recruitment Process

  1. First Interview with someone from the Talent team (30/45 mins).
  2. Technical Interview with our Senior Developers (1h30).

Our Values

  • Growing every day.
  • Including everyone.
  • Relationships built on honesty and ethics.
  • Inspiring solutions.
  • Winning together.

YLD is an equal-opportunity employer and values diversity of all kinds. We offer a remote-first working environment, meaning that flexible working and work-life balance come as standard for all employees.

Similar jobs

Last update: 23 minutes ago

9am logo
9am

Lead Software Engineer - JavaScript/React/Node.js/TypeScript/API/GraphQL

Join as a Lead Software Engineer specializing in JavaScript, React, Node.js, and TypeScript. Fully remote, long-term contract.

EverCommerce logo
EverCommerce

Senior Full-Stack Software Engineer - Node/React

Join EverCommerce as a Senior Full-Stack Engineer, focusing on Node/React for the EverPro platform. Remote work in USA/Canada.

RV LIFE logo
RV LIFE

Principal Full-Stack Engineer - React & React Native

Join RV LIFE as a Principal Full-Stack Engineer to lead React & React Native projects, focusing on scalable serverless solutions in a remote setting.

American Express logo
American Express

Full Stack Engineer - React, Node.js

Join American Express as a Full Stack Engineer working with React and Node.js in a hybrid role in New York.

Motion Recruitment logo
Motion Recruitment

Senior Frontend Developer with JavaScript, Node.js, and React

Join as a Senior Frontend Developer working with JavaScript, Node.js, and React in a hybrid role in Norcross, GA.

Lumenalta (formerly Clevertech) logo
Lumenalta (formerly Clevertech)

Senior Node.js Engineer

Join Lumenalta as a Senior Node.js Engineer. Work remotely on innovative projects using JavaScript, Node.js, AWS Lambda, and more.

Kilowott logo
Kilowott

Mid and Senior Node.js Developer

Seeking Mid and Senior Node.js Developer for server-side logic, database management, and performance optimization in Indiana, US.

TheyDo - Journey Management logo
TheyDo - Journey Management

Senior Backend Engineer (Node.js)

Join TheyDo as a Senior Backend Engineer (Node.js) to shape scalable architectures and work on ambitious projects in a fully remote role.

Grafana Labs logo
Grafana Labs

Senior Full-Stack Web Developer

Remote Senior Full-Stack Web Developer role at Grafana Labs, focusing on Next.js, Node.js, and Tailwind CSS.

Big Health logo
Big Health

Senior Software Engineer, Full Stack (React Native & Python)

Join Big Health as a Senior Software Engineer to develop full-stack applications using React Native and Python. Remote role in the US.

Selego logo
Selego

Full Stack Developer (React.js/Node.js)

Join Selego as a Full Stack Developer in Amsterdam. Work with React.js, Node.js, and more in a dynamic startup environment.

Travel Diaries logo
Travel Diaries

Full-stack Engineer with Expertise in .NET, React, and Next.js

Join Journal Lab as a Full-stack Engineer with expertise in .NET, React, and Next.js. Work remotely on innovative web applications.

Aleph logo
Aleph

Frontend Engineer, AI

Join Aleph as a Frontend Engineer focusing on AI to develop innovative features using React.js and AI technologies in a remote role.

Replit logo
Replit

Senior Mobile Engineer - React Native

Join Replit as a Senior Mobile Engineer to shape AI-driven mobile experiences using React Native, Typescript, and more.

LILT logo
LILT

Senior Full Stack Engineer (Java, React, MySQL)

Join LILT as a Senior Full Stack Engineer, working with Java, React, and MySQL to drive AI translation solutions. Remote with future hybrid work.

BuildOps logo
BuildOps

Full Stack Engineer with React and Node.js

Join BuildOps as a Full Stack Engineer, working with React and Node.js in a hybrid role in Santa Monica.

Inclusively logo
Inclusively

Mid-Level Software Engineer - React Native, Python, Kotlin

Join as a Software Engineer to build social gaming features using React Native, Python, and Kotlin. Remote role with competitive salary and equity.

ECS logo
ECS

Remote JavaScript Developer

Join ECS as a Remote JavaScript Developer, working with React.js and Vue.js to build high-performance web applications.

Squadformers logo
Squadformers

Full-Stack Software Engineer (JavaScript, Node.js, Vue.js)

Join Squadformers as a Full-Stack Software Engineer, working remotely on innovative projects with JavaScript, Node.js, and Vue.js.

Cloudflight logo
Cloudflight

Senior React Developer

Join Cloudflight as a Senior React Developer to build high-performance web applications using React, TypeScript, and Tailwind CSS.

Zalando logo
Zalando

Senior Software Engineer (Fullstack) with Node.js and TypeScript

Join Zalando as a Senior Software Engineer (Fullstack) with Node.js and TypeScript expertise. Drive innovation in a hybrid work environment.

Rogo logo
Rogo

Senior Full-Stack Software Engineer (React, TypeScript)

Join Rogo as a Senior Full-Stack Software Engineer to develop cutting-edge AI tools in NYC.

DevsData Tech Talent LLC - IT Recruitment logo
DevsData Tech Talent LLC - IT Recruitment

Fullstack Developer (React, TypeScript)

Join as a Fullstack Developer to build Web3 solutions using React, TypeScript, and Solidity. Fully remote, competitive hourly rate.

palmetto logo
palmetto

Software Development Engineer III - Full Stack (MERN Stack)

Join Palmetto as a Software Development Engineer III to work on full-stack development using the MERN stack in a remote, agile environment.